About the Role
In this role you will be:
- Responsible for patient meal deliveries and assisting with food preparation for patients, staff, cafe and functions.
- Ensure a high standard of quality in hospital food production and cleanliness within the department, adhering to the required Food Safety Plan, relevant HACCP standards and Hospital policy.
- Reports to the Hotel Services Manager and collaborates with a diverse team.
- Ensure a high standard of hospital cleaning to wards.
About You:
To excel in this role, you should possess and experience in commercial kitchens, preferably in prep or healthcare settings.
Key Qualifications and attributes:
- Any formal food safety qualifications will be highly regarded.
- Whilst not essential, possessing a Cert III in Commercial Cookery is highly beneficial.
- Proficiency in Catering to a diverse range of dietary requirements is necessary.
- Experience in cleaning will be highly regarded.
